As NVIDIA approaches its much-anticipated earnings announcement on February 26, 2025, all eyes are on the technology titan, whose colossal $3.3 trillion market cap dominates the semiconductor landscape. This isn’t just another earnings report. It’s a dance of expectations and revelations, a grand performance where investors seek harmony between reported numbers and their lofty forecasts.
In a year that saw NVIDIA amass $113 billion in revenue and secure a staggering $71 billion in operating profits, the stakes are undeniably high. With profit margins this expansive, NVIDIA seems to glide above its competition, propelled by innovators dreaming in silicon and stockholders hoping for a crescendo of stock value. Yet, the real intrigue lies in the market’s reaction, tied as intricately to emotion as it is to numbers.
Reflecting on NVIDIA’s recent history offers thrills and chills. Over the past five years, one-day post-earnings returns flipped positive 55% of the time. A coin toss with a slight tilt. More recently, this probability nudged to 58%, infusing just a hint more optimism. Traders analyze past performances with alchemist precision, deciphering patterns like ancient runes. On outstanding days, stock prices soared beyond 20% in 24 hours—a dance of numbers that rivals any crescendo.

How-To Steps & Life Hacks for Analyzing Earnings Reports
To analyze NVIDIA’s earnings report effectively:
1. Review Historical Performance: Check past earnings, focusing on revenue growth, profit margins, and stock price reactions the day post-earnings.
2. Compare with Analyst Estimates: Look at consensus estimates and evaluate if NVIDIA meets or beats these expectations, which often significantly impacts stock movements.
3. Identify Key Metrics: Focus on key financial indicators like gross margin, net income, and EPS (Earnings Per Share).
4. Consider Market Trends: Understand how broader economic trends and tech industry developments could affect NVIDIA’s performance.
Real-World Use Cases
NVIDIA is celebrated for its pioneering graphics processing units (GPUs), which are integral to:
– Artificial Intelligence (AI): Fueling advancements in AI applications, including natural language processing and autonomous driving.
– Gaming Industry: Powering immersive graphics and smooth gameplay experiences.
– Data Centers: Enhancing computational power for cloud computing and big data analytics.
Market Forecasts & Industry Trends
The global semiconductor industry is on an upward trajectory. According to Gartner, it’s expected to grow by an average of 7% annually through 2025, driven by increasing demand for AI, the Internet of Things (IoT), and 5G technologies. NVIDIA stands to benefit immensely from these evolving technologies.

Controversies & Limitations
NVIDIA has faced backlash over:
– Supply Chain Constraints: Resulting in product shortages and delayed launches.
– Climate Impact: Concerns over the carbon footprint of large-scale data centers powered by its GPUs.
Features, Specs & Pricing
NVIDIA’s GeForce RTX 40 series GPUs boast features like real-time ray tracing, AI-enhanced graphics, and superior DLSS (Deep Learning Super Sampling) capabilities. Prices vary greatly, depending on performance levels and model types.
